#50EDEA Color
#50EDEA is rgb(80, 237, 234) in RGB, hsl(179, 81%, 62%) in HSL, and about cmyk(66%, 0%, 1%, 7%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Fluorescent Blue (#15F4EE),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.28.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#50EDEA Channel Values
How #50EDEA bre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 80 · G 237 · B 234 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 179° · S 81% · L 62%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 179° · S 66% · V 93%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 66% · M 0% · Y 1% · K 7%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.43:1 vs white · 14.64: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#50EDEA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#50EDEA?
#50EDEA is a light teal — rgb(80, 237, 234) in RGB and hsl(179, 81%, 62%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Fluorescent Blue (#15F4EE),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.28.
What is the RGB value of #50EDEA?
#50EDEA is rgb(80, 237, 234) — red 80, green 237, and blue 234 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#50EDEA?
#50EDEA converts to approximately cmyk(66%, 0%, 1%, 7%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#50EDEA be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#50EDEA scores 1.43:1 against white and 14.64: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#50EDEA as a CSS color keyword?
No. #50EDEA is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is turquoise (#40E0D0) at a CIE76 distance of 8.5,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
